What are nitrogenous bases?
Back
Nitrogenous bases are the building blocks of DNA and RNA, consisting of adenine (A), thymine (T), cytosine (C), guanine (G) in DNA, and uracil (U) in RNA. They pair specifically (A with T, C with G) to form the structure of nucleic acids.

What is a complementary DNA strand?
Back
A complementary DNA strand is a strand that pairs with another DNA strand according to the base pairing rules (A-T and C-G). For example, if one strand has the sequence ACGT, the complementary strand will have the sequence TGCA.

What is a mutation?
Back
A mutation is a change in the DNA sequence that can lead to changes in the structure and function of proteins. Mutations can be caused by various factors, including environmental influences and errors during DNA replication.

What is sickle-cell anemia?
Back
Sickle-cell anemia is a genetic disorder caused by a mutation in the hemoglobin gene, leading to the production of abnormal hemoglobin that causes red blood cells to become sickle-shaped, resulting in various health complications.

What type of mutation is a substitution?
Back
A substitution mutation is a type of mutation where one base pair in the DNA sequence is replaced by another. This can lead to changes in the amino acid sequence of proteins.

What is transcription in genetics?
Back
Transcription is the process by which the information in a DNA sequence is copied into a complementary RNA sequence, specifically mRNA, which then carries the genetic information to the ribosome for protein synthesis.

What is the role of mRNA?
Back
mRNA (messenger RNA) serves as a template for protein synthesis, carrying the genetic information from DNA in the nucleus to the ribosomes in the cytoplasm, where proteins are made.
